Elon Musk- I Would Not Vote for Biden

On the latest “Elon, Inc.” podcast, ee assess the aftermath of an especially gonzo week in the life of Elon Musk—one in which the billionaire CEO delivered the first production units of his company’s latest vehicle (the Cybertruck), weighed in on his preferred candidates for the 2024 election (neither Donald Trump nor Joe Biden) and offered a message to the chief executive of one of America’s most beloved brands (“Go f— yourself”).

What do you hear when you sit in silence? For artist Rose B. Simpson, that question is the beginning of all art. She comes from a line of ceramic artists stretching back generations and, as part of her multidisciplinary work, she also builds custom lowrider cars. (If that sounds like a contradiction, that’s kind of the point.) In conversation with “Design Matters” podcast host Debbie Millman, Simpson invites you to find your own aesthetic — not by searching, but by listening. (Recorded at TEDNext 2025 on November 10, 2025)
